WebDistributive Law. The "Distributive Law" is the BEST one of all, but needs careful attention. This is what it lets us do: 3 lots of (2+4) is the same as 3 lots of 2 plus 3 lots of 4. WebNov 11, 2024 · Associativity is used when there are two operators in an expression having the same precedence. Associativity is worthless when the order of the operators is different. It is crucial to realize that an operator's associativity does not determine the evaluation order of its operands. Let's imagine that we wish to compute 12/3*2 in the C ...
